Finland - Nurses and Midwives Density
Since 2014, Finland Nurses and Midwives Density grew 0.1% year on year. In 2019, the country was number 5 among other countries in Nurses and Midwives Density at 15.15 Units (Persons) Per Thousand Persons. Finland is overtaken by Iceland, which was number 4 with 15.69 Units (Persons) Per Thousand Persons and is followed by Ireland with 14.29 Units (Persons) Per Thousand Persons. Monaco ranked the highest with 20.26 Units (Persons) Per Thousand Persons in 2014, an increase of 8% versus 2013. Kenya recorded the best 5 years average growth at +31.2% per year, while Philippines witnessed the worst performance at -40.9% per year.
